Passenger Power: Seating Capacity and Comfort in Your Pacifica

When you’re talking about a mini van Chrysler Pacifica how many passengers, the answer typically ranges from 7 to 8, depending on the specific configuration. Most models come standard with seating for seven, featuring two captain’s chairs in the second row. However, many trims offer an optional second-row bench seat, boosting the total capacity to eight passengers. This choice between seven or eight seats is crucial, as it directly impacts both passenger comfort and the available space for your travel bags.

Second-Row Options: Captain’s Chairs vs. Bench Seat

  • Seven-Passenger Layout (2+2+3): This configuration features two comfortable captain’s chairs in the second row. These provide individual space and armrests, making for a more luxurious experience for those seated there. It also creates a convenient pass-through to the third row, which is great for parents accessing children or for quick entry/exit.
  • Eight-Passenger Layout (2+3+3): Opting for the second-row bench seat means you can fit three passengers in the middle row. This is ideal for larger families or carpooling duties. While it foregoes the individual luxury of captain’s chairs, it maximizes passenger count, which is often the priority for big families.

The Magic of Stow ‘n Go: Unlocking Unrivaled Cargo Versatility

One of the most celebrated and revolutionary features of the Chrysler Pacifica (and its predecessors) is the ingenious Stow ‘n Go seating system. This isn’t just a clever name; it’s a game-changer for anyone who needs flexible space. Imagine this: in a matter of seconds, you can transform your passenger van into a cavernous cargo hauler without ever having to remove heavy seats from the vehicle. That’s the power of Stow ‘n Go.

Both the second-row and third-row seats are designed to fold completely flat into hidden compartments built into the floor. This transformation creates a perfectly flat loading floor, which is ideal for sliding in large, bulky items that would never fit in a conventional SUV. No more wrestling with heavy seats, finding storage space in your garage, or compromising on what you can transport. The convenience is truly unparalleled.

How Stow ‘n Go Works its Wonders

  • Second-Row Stow ‘n Go: With a few simple pulls and pushes, the second-row bucket seats (or the bench seat in 8-passenger models) literally vanish into the floor. The floor bins where they store also double as convenient storage compartments when the seats are up, perfect for stashing emergency kits, toys, or small bags.
  • Third-Row Stow ‘n Go: The third-row bench seat is equally simple to stow. It flips and folds backward into a deep well at the rear of the vehicle, also creating a perfectly flat floor that extends all the way to the front seats. This third-row well also serves as a handy cargo space even when the seats are in use, an excellent spot for groceries or smaller bags that you want to keep secure and out of sight.

The beauty of Stow ‘n Go lies in its adaptability. You can stow just one second-row seat for a long item, or stow all rear seats for maximum cargo capacity. This flexibility directly answers the question of mini van Chrysler Pacifica how many passengers travel bags, as the more seats you stow, the more travel bags (and other items) you can carry.

Packing for Adventure: How Many Travel Bags Fit in a Chrysler Pacifica?

Now, for the million-dollar question: how many travel bags can you truly fit into a Chrysler Pacifica? The answer, as you might guess, varies significantly depending on how many passengers you’re carrying and how you configure the Stow ‘n Go seating. Let’s break it down with some practical examples.

With All Seats Up (7 or 8 Passengers)

Even with all three rows of seats occupied, the Pacifica offers a surprisingly generous 32.3 cubic feet (approximately 915 liters) of cargo space behind the third row. This is a crucial advantage over many SUVs, which often leave very little room for luggage once their third row is in use. What does 32.3 cubic feet look like in terms of travel bags?

  • Roughly 4-5 standard carry-on suitcases (22x14x9 inches/56x36x23 cm) stacked neatly.
  • Alternatively, you could fit 2-3 medium-sized checked bags (27x18x10 inches/69x46x25 cm) along with some smaller duffel bags or backpacks.

This configuration is perfect for a family of seven or eight heading to the airport for a short trip, or for a weekend getaway where everyone brings one main bag. The deep well behind the third row is excellent for keeping bags secure and preventing them from sliding around.

With the Third Row Folded (5 Passengers)

This is where the Pacifica starts to show off its true cargo prowess. By simply folding the third-row Stow ‘n Go seat into the floor, you instantly unleash a massive 87.5 cubic feet (approximately 2478 liters) of cargo space. This is more than enough for almost any family vacation or a serious shopping spree.

  • You could easily accommodate 6-8 large checked suitcases (depending on their exact dimensions and how skillfully you pack).
  • Alternatively, it’s perfect for larger items like a stroller, a portable playpen, and still plenty of room for multiple travel bags.
  • Think about sports equipment – golf clubs, camping gear, multiple cooler boxes – all can fit comfortably with the third row stowed.

This configuration is ideal for a family of five needing significant luggage space for a week-long vacation, a road trip across the country, or even moving smaller pieces of furniture.

With Both Second and Third Rows Folded (2 Passengers)

When you need to move mountains (or at least a small mountain of belongings), the Pacifica transforms into an incredible cargo van. With both the second and third rows stowed, you gain a colossal 140.5 cubic feet (approximately 3978 liters) of flat cargo space. This is comparable to many full-size cargo vans!

  • At this point, you’re not just fitting travel bags; you’re fitting *everything*. We’re talking about dozens of carry-on bags, large moving boxes, lumber, bicycles, or even a kayak.
  • It’s the ultimate configuration for moving house, transporting large purchases, or carrying an entire family’s luggage for an extended international trip (if two people are traveling).

This maximum cargo capacity is a huge differentiator for the Pacifica, providing versatility that few other passenger vehicles can match.

Does the Chrysler Pacifica offer all-wheel drive?

Yes, newer models of the Chrysler Pacifica (from 2020 onwards) are available with an all-wheel-drive (AWD) system, providing enhanced traction and control, especially useful in varying weather conditions or on unpaved roads. This adds another layer of versatility for families seeking more capability.

What kind of fuel efficiency can I expect from a Chrysler Pacifica?

The standard gasoline-powered Chrysler Pacifica typically offers competitive fuel efficiency for its class, often around 19-20 MPG in the city and 28 MPG on the highway (approximately 8-9 km/l city, 11-12 km/l highway). There is also a Pacifica Hybrid model that delivers significantly better fuel economy, capable of electric-only range before switching to hybrid power.

Are there child seat anchors in all Pacifica seats?

The Chrysler Pacifica is designed with family safety in mind, offering LATCH (Lower Anchors and Tethers for Children) connectors for car seats in multiple positions. Typically, the second-row seats each have a full set of LATCH anchors, and the third row often includes tether anchors, allowing for flexible and secure installation of child safety seats.

What are some notable technology features in the Chrysler Pacifica?

The Pacifica is packed with technology, often featuring a large Uconnect infotainment touchscreen with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, available navigation, and an optional FamCAM interior camera to monitor rear passengers. Many models also offer a rear-seat entertainment system with dual screens, USB ports, and a variety of safety and driver-assistance features like adaptive cruise control and blind-spot monitoring.

How does the Pacifica compare to SUVs in terms of cargo space?

The Pacifica generally surpasses most SUVs in terms of usable cargo space, especially when comparing vehicles with three rows of seating. Its unique Stow ‘n Go system allows for a completely flat and expansive cargo floor that SUVs typically cannot match without removing cumbersome seats, making it superior for hauling large items or numerous travel bags.
